[0049] The preparation method of methacryloyl chitosan, specifically:

[0050] Dissolve chitosan in acetic acid aqueous solution, stir evenly, add methacrylic anhydride, and then place it at 0-4°C for 4h-6h reaction to obtain methacrylated polysaccharide solution, and then add methacryl Put the purified polysaccharide solution into a dialysis bag with a molecular weight of 3000-7000 and dialyze for 5-7 days, then freeze-dry at -55-60°C for 48-72 hours, and finally freeze-dry at -18-25°C Refrigerate, reserve;

[0051] The mass ratio of chitosan, acetic acid aqueous solution and methacrylic anhydride is 1:100:1~2;

[0052] In the acetic acid aqueous solution, the volume ratio of acetic acid to water is 1:50-100;

Embodiment 1

[0078] A method for preparing a hydrogel ink suitable for 3D bioprinting, specifically implemented according to the following steps:

[0079] Step 1. Dissolve methylpropionylated chitosan in high-sugar DMEM cell culture medium, and freeze it in an ice-water bath at 0°C for 15 minutes, then add propylene F127 to the cell culture medium to obtain a mixed solution, and then Then the mixed solution is centrifuged to separate the solid from the liquid, and the obtained solid is refrigerated at 4°C for later use;

[0080] The mass ratio of methylpropionylated chitosan, high-sugar DMEM cell culture medium, and propylene F127 is 2:100:20;

[0081] The centrifugation rate is 500rpm, and the centrifugation time is 3min;

Embodiment 2

[0100] A method for preparing a hydrogel ink suitable for 3D bioprinting, specifically implemented according to the following steps:

[0101] Step 1. Dissolve hydroxyethyl chitosan in low-sugar DMEM cell culture medium, and freeze it in an ice-water bath at 1°C for 20 minutes, then add aminated F127 to the cell culture medium to obtain a mixed solution, and then mix the The liquid is treated by centrifugation to separate the solid from the liquid, and the obtained solid matter is refrigerated at 4°C for later use;

[0102] The mass ratio of hydroxyethyl chitosan, cell culture medium and aminated F127 is 5:100:25;

[0103] The centrifugation rate is 800rpm, and the centrifugation time is 3min;

[0104] Among them, the manufacturer of hydroxyethyl chitosan is Wuhan Yuancheng Gongchuang Technology Co., Ltd., the degree of substitution of hydroxyethyl chitosan is 85%, and the viscosity is 400mPa·s;

Abstract

The invention discloses a method for preparing hydrogel ink applicable to 3D (three-dimensional) biological printing. The method is particularly implemented according to steps of dissolving chitosan derivatives in cell culture media; freezing the cell culture media under ice-water bath conditions; adding Pluronic F127 derivatives into the cell culture media; carrying out centrifugation; carrying out refrigeration; dissolving natural polysaccharides in deionized water to obtain liquid; adding sodium periodate and ethylene glycol into the liquid; stirring the sodium periodate, the ethylene glycol and the liquid under dark conditions; carrying out dialysis; carrying out freeze drying; carrying out refrigeration and then dissolving substances in cell culture media; ultimately immersing hydrogel precursors in polysaccharide cross-linking agent culture medium solution; carrying out stable cross-linking to obtain the hydrogel ink. The method has the advantages that reaction on chitosan or thederivatives of the chitosan and natural polysaccharide cross-linking agents is utilized, accordingly, the structural stability of the hydrogel ink can be improved, polysaccharide molecules can be functionally modified, and the biological application of the hydrogel ink can be enriched.

technical field [0001] The invention belongs to the technical field of preparation of hydrogel ink materials, and in particular relates to a preparation method of hydrogel ink suitable for 3D bioprinting. Background technique [0002] 3D bioprinting is an important technical means to use the principle of additive manufacturing to position and assemble biological materials and cell units, and to manufacture tissue engineering scaffolds and tissues and organs. The key core of 3D bioprinting is to print ink materials. The "hydrogel" scaffold is similar to the extracellular matrix structure of organisms and can load cells in situ. It is an ideal 3D printing bioink. 3D printing hydrogel bio-ink has four basic features: (1) Adjustable viscosity; viscosity is the resistance to the flow of hydrogel precursor sol, and adjustable viscosity is suitable for designing the printing method, printing parameter range and delay time.
